Overview

The Hammond Power C3F015BBS is a 15 kVA, 600V Class three-phase potted distribution transformer designed for commercial and industrial power distribution. With primary voltage configurations of 208V (PV) and secondary outputs of 208Y/120V (SV), this transformer delivers reliable voltage regulation and efficient power distribution in demanding environments. Its potted construction provides superior protection against moisture, dust, and contaminants, ensuring long-term durability with minimal maintenance. The unit features a heavy-duty Type 3R ventilated enclosure, pre-installed grounding lugs, and front-accessible high/low voltage terminals with lugs for copper or aluminum cables. Factory-installed vibration isolation pads and outward-facing mounting holes simplify installation, while optional wall-mounting kits (DW3) and standard floor-mounting feet offer flexible deployment. Certified to UL 1562 and CSA C22.2 No. 47, the C3F015BBS meets stringent safety and performance standards. Ideal for lighting, HVAC, and small power distribution in commercial buildings, office towers, shopping plazas, and industrial facilities, this transformer combines energy efficiency (97.89% at 35% load) with robust construction. Manufactured in the USA, it is backed by Hammond Power’s reputation for quality and reliability.

What is Hammond Power's warranty policy?

Hammond Power provides a standard one-year warranty on all products, covering defects in workmanship and materials. Products will be repaired or replaced free of charge if found defective upon factory inspection. The warranty does not cover damage from improper handling, incorrect application, or faulty installation.
